Similar test
From Encyclopedia of Mathematics
A statistical test for testing a compound hypothesis
against a compound alternative
(
), the power function (cf. Power function of a test) of which takes on
the same, fixed, value from the interval
.
See Neyman structure; Behrens–Fisher problem; Similarity region.
